Our Story
Queensland Tamil Mandram supports Tamil families through cultural continuity, language preservation, and community-led programs designed for long-term connection.
The mandram creates spaces where families can celebrate heritage, strengthen belonging, and build enduring local relationships while contributing to a wider multicultural Queensland.
QTM grows through volunteer participation, community trust, and programs that help preserve culture in ways that remain practical and relevant for future generations.
